It's feasible that due to their boosted blood flow to the skin, sauna use might have a positive impact on skin health and wellness. Nevertheless, because of the reduced humidity, completely dry saunas might not be suitable for people with skin conditions characterized by dry, half-cracked, or itchy skin 11, such as psoriasis. Steam bath with a wet warmth might be a better choice for dermatitis, dermatitis, and comparable problems.

Did you know that regular sauna use can additionally save your life? Sauna usage is among those rare wellness benefits that is both highly rooted in several countries and cultures and has lasting study studies to back it up. The majority of people consider Finland when it concerns saunas.


However there is likewise some archaeological proof that the ancient Mayans were the very first known individuals to recognize the benefit of saunas, concerning 3,000 years ago, when they developed sweat houses. The very first saunas built in Africa were additionally designed to help with sweating to assist clear the body of infectious condition


Researchers discovered lowered danger of sudden cardiac death, deadly coronary heart disease, deadly heart disease (CVD), and all-cause mortality in sauna users. Surprisingly, the danger reduction was likewise dose-dependent. For instance, for men that reported using the sauna 4-7 times each week, the risk of deadly coronary heart problem was considerably reduced when contrasted to guys who made use of the sauna once regular.
